Dissertation Supervisor - Business & Tourism - Great Pay (Streatham)
We are seeking Dissertation Supervisors to support our vision of Changing lives through education.
Are you someone who can guide students through the process of writing their dissertations? Do you have previous experience of providing dissertation supervision combined with demonstrable experience in Business and Tourism Management as well working with adult learners from diverse backgrounds? We want to hear from you! You will join the teaching teams and support the research project module.
You will be allocated up to 20 project students and you will be required to provide 10 hours of supervision plus marking time per student supervised.
Salary: £250 per student in all locations. This includes supervisory time, formative feedback, 1 st marking and 2 nd marking as well as ad-hoc meetings.
Department: Academic/Canterbury Christ Church University (CCCU) partnership
Location: London (West and East), Birmingham, Manchester, Leeds - (On-Site)
What you'll be doing:
Academic Supervision
- Support students in defining and refining their research questions and objectives.
- Advise on appropriate research methodologies and ethical considerations.
- Guide students in conducting literature reviews and sourcing relevant materials.
- Provide structured feedback on dissertation drafts and monitor progress.
- Ensure dissertations meet required academic, institutional and PSRB standards.
Student Support
- Maintain regular contact with assigned students through scheduled supervision meetings.
- Encourage independent thinking and scholarly development.
- Identify and address academic or personal challenges that may be affecting progress.
- Promote inclusive and supportive learning environments.
About You:
- Qualified to at least a Masters Level degree in a related discipline area.
- Demonstrable experience in academic research and dissertation supervision.
- Experience of working in Higher Education
- Knowledge of qualitative and quantitative methodology
- Knowledge of statistical programmes and secondary data analysis
- Strong interpersonal and communication skills.
- Knowledge of research ethics, methodologies, and academic writing conventions.
- Understanding of, and passion for, both higher education and working with a diverse student body, especially mature students from a widening participation background.
- Willing to work occasional weekends and evenings, and travel to our various campuses.
- Good IT skills working on all Microsoft packages.
Desirable:
- External examiner experience
- Relevant industry related experience.
